Various bug fixes
[xogo.git] / variants / Berolina / class.js
index ef0ba89..18057f2 100644 (file)
@@ -5,7 +5,8 @@ export default class BerolinaRules extends ChessRules {
 
   pieces(color, x, y) {
     let res = super.pieces(color, x, y);
-    res['p'] = BerolinaPawnSpec(color);
+    const initRank = ((color == 'w' && x == 6) || (color == 'b' && x == 1));
+    res['p'] = BerolinaPawnSpec(color, initRank);
     return res;
   }